Early Life

John Panozzo was born on September 20th, 1948 in Illinois. He grew up in the Roseland neighborhood on the South Side of Chicago with his fraternal twin brother, Chuck. Music was a big part of their upbringing, and John showed a natural talent for drumming at a young age.

Forming Tradewinds

At the age of thirteen, John founded a band called Tradewinds with his neighbor and future Styx bandmate Dennis DeYoung. This early collaboration laid the foundation for John's future success in the music industry. From a young age, it was clear that he was destined for greatness.

Personal Struggles

Despite his professional success, John faced personal struggles throughout his life. In the mid-1990s, he was diagnosed with cirrhosis of the liver, which prevented him from touring with Styx. His battle with the disease ultimately led to his premature death, leaving behind a void in the music industry and in the hearts of his fans.

Legacy

Years after his passing, John Panozzo's memory continues to be honored by those who knew and loved him. Tommy Shaw, his fellow bandmate in Styx, paid tribute to John in a poignant song titled "Dear John."
